Results you may expect from using jane iredale POMMISST Hydration Spray:

Based on the ingredient analysis by CreamScan, these are the key benefits you can expect from using jane iredale POMMISST Hydration Spray:

  • Moderate moisturizing. It has a moisturizing rating of 5.1 out of 10.
  • Soothing: jane iredale POMMISST Hydration Spray contains a high concentration of soothing ingredients, which may help to reduce irritation and calm the skin.
  • Antioxidant protection.

How moisturizing is it?

Quite moisturizing: jane iredale POMMISST Hydration Spray has a moisturizing rating of 5.1 out of 10.

Is it more humectant or occlusive? Significantly more humectant. It has a low occlusivity of 0.2 out of 10 and a maximum humectancy of 10 out of 10, due to the high content of Aloe Barbadensis Leaf Juice Powder (est. ≈6.0%), Camellia Sinensis Leaf Extract (est. ≈3.0%) and Laminaria Digitata Extract (est. ≈2.0%).

Anti-wrinkle efficacy

According to CreamScan analysis, jane iredale POMMISST Hydration Spray has a zero anti-wrinkle rating.

It contains Camellia Sinensis Leaf Extract and Olea Europaea (Olive) Leaf Extract, two ingredients marketed as effective in reducing wrinkles. However, the studies supporting the anti-wrinkle claims of these ingredients provide insufficient evidence of efficacy according to CreamScan Research Evaluation Standards. Therefore, these ingredients do not generate the anti-wrinkle rating.

Antioxidant benefits

We estimate that jane iredale POMMISST Hydration Spray is rich (> 3%) in antioxidants, specifically Punica Granatum Extract (est. ≈4.0%), Camellia Sinensis Leaf Extract (est. ≈3.0%) and Laminaria Digitata Extract (est. ≈2.0%).

A key benefit of antioxidants is their ability to reduce oxidative stress caused by free radicals and therefore prevent accelerated skin aging. Studies also show that antioxidants can protect against environmental damage such as UV radiation and pollution, and help reduce inflammation and skin redness.

Skin soothing

Based on the ingredient list analysis, jane iredale POMMISST Hydration Spray is rich (> 5%) in soothing ingredients, particularly Aloe Barbadensis Leaf Juice Powder (est. ≈6.0%) and Camellia Sinensis Leaf Extract (est. ≈3.0%).

When applied to the skin, compounds of soothing ingredients, such as triglycerides, phospholipids, fatty acids, phenolic compounds, and antioxidants, work together to soothe the skin through various mechanisms: reducing inflammation, promoting wound healing, repairing the skin barrier, and providing antimicrobial and antioxidant activities.

Ingredients explained

Water
Est. %80
Function
Origin
The most used ingredient in skincare. Its concentration defines the product texture: rich creams may have about 50% of water while a light jelly about 90%. Water doesn’t moisturize the skin by itself and is used in skincare as a solvent for other ingredients.
Aloe Barbadensis Leaf Juice Powder
Est. %6
Function
Origin
Extracted from dried aloe vera leaves, it has the same effects as fresh aloe vera juice – it is humectant moisturizing, refreshing, and soothing. This powder can also serve as a gelling agent when mixed with water.
Punica Granatum Extract
Est. %4
Function
Origin
An extract made from pomegranate fruit. The fleshy and juicy part of the fruit mainly contains antioxidant red pigments and polyphenols. The rinds contain large amounts of tannins, which are astringent and leave the skin feeling tightened and refreshed.
Camellia Sinensis Leaf Extract
Est. %3
Function
Origin
An antioxidant green tea extract. In the deeper layers, it slows down the destruction of collagen, elastin, and hyaluronic acid – thus delaying the signs of aging. It also acts as an anti-acne, soothing, moisturizing, and emollient ingredient.
Laminaria Digitata Extract
Est. %2
Function
Origin
An antioxidant extract obtained from an edible brown seaweed called oarweed. It contains many humectant and gelling polysaccharides, as well as beneficial minerals.
Rosmarinus Officinalis (Rosemary) Leaf Extract
Est. %1.5
Function
Origin
A soothing and astringent extract derived from the fragrant, spicy leaves of rosemary. It has strong antioxidant properties. Rosemary extract can reduce signs of inflammation and also acts as an emollient and antimicrobial agent.
Olea Europaea (Olive) Leaf Extract
Est. %1.3
Function
Origin
An antioxidant and fragrant extract from the leaves of the olive tree. It contains a promising anti-aging compound called Oleuropein, and a prospective anti-pigment compound called Cornoside.
Raphanus Sativus (Radish) Root Extract
Est. %1
Function
Origin
An extract obtained from the radish root with antioxidant sulfur compounds and red plant pigments.
Punica Granatum Seed Oil
Est. %0.3
Function
Origin
An emollient and occlusive moisturizing pomegranate seed oil that is rich in a rare fatty acid called punicic acid, and that contains a high content of the antioxidant vitamin E.
Alcohol
Est. %0.3
Function
Origin
An effective antimicrobial ingredient that kills bacteria, fungi, and even some viruses. It is also an excellent solvent and astringent. Alcohol helps to create lighter and less viscous products. It can, however, be dehydrating and skin-sensitizing.
